The Show Low City Council unanimously approved the consent calendar, which included a proclamation for Martin Luther King Jr. Day of Service and routine project acceptances and agreements; no items were pulled for separate discussion.

Show Low City Council unanimously approved its consent calendar during the meeting, adopting a set of routine proclamations, project acceptances and standard agreements.
